Adobe Flash Professional CS5 consentirà agli utenti di creare applicazioni iPhone utilizzando il familiare Action Script. Le applicazioni create in questo modo verranno poi vendute classicamente nell'AppStore. Ma ciò non significa che Flash sia nuovamente supportato su iPhone e che possiamo visualizzare le pagine Flash in Safari.
Tuttavia il nuovo strumento per la creazione di applicazioni verrà sicuramente accolto favorevolmente da un gran numero di sviluppatori e ovviamente anche noi utenti ne trarremo vantaggio. Esistono molte app Adobe Air che ora verranno eseguite con modifiche minime e davvero facili da compilare per le esigenze dell'iPhone. I siti web possono essere compilati allo stesso modo.
Flash non ha creato un ambiente in cui un'applicazione per iPhone potrebbe essere eseguita, ma un'applicazione creata in questo modo si compila direttamente come una normale applicazione nativa per iPhone. La distribuzione avverrà classicamente tramite Appstore, e l'utente non si accorgerà nemmeno della differenza. Per poter distribuire le applicazioni sull'Appstore, lo sviluppatore dovrà pagare ad Apple la consueta quota annuale e le applicazioni saranno sottoposte al classico processo di approvazione. Ma potremmo certamente vedere un’ondata di nuove interessanti applicazioni.
Personalmente, come utente, mi aspetterei una differenza. A mio avviso, le applicazioni scritte in questo modo saranno molto meno ottimizzate rispetto a quelle scritte in Xcode e potrebbero quindi impegnare maggiormente la batteria.
Per quanto riguarda Flash in Safari, per ora non è cambiato nulla in questo ambito e personalmente mi trovo meglio senza Flash nel browser. Ma se Flash dovesse mai apparire in Safari, spero che ci sia un pulsante per disattivarlo.
Na Pagina Adobe Labs puoi leggere qualche informazione in più e guardare un video dimostrativo qui. C'è anche un collegamento a diverse applicazioni create in Adobe Flash CS5, ma queste applicazioni non si trovano nell'Appstore ceco. Ma se lo sei creato un account negli Stati Uniti, quindi ovviamente puoi provare queste applicazioni.
Mi preoccupa di più che l'AppStore non diventi ancora più affollato di applicazioni e giochi primitivi in Flash.
Ebbene, anche progettare qualcosa in Photoshop non è facile. Quindi non sono preoccupato che Adobe Flash CS5 inondi l'App Store con app inutili.
Secondo me il numero di giochi nell'App Store aumenterà, sarà un aumento significativo, perché Flash è perfetto per questo.
Allo stesso modo, la quantità di zavorra aumenterà, perché dopotutto lo sviluppo per iPhone sarà più semplice. Céčko può essere, ed è, un problema insormontabile per molti programmatori per molte ragioni.
E poi naturalmente c'è l'ottimizzazione già menzionata, il consumo della batteria, ecc. Questo è anche il motivo per cui Apple non ha installato Garbage Collector sull'iPhone.
Ho la stessa identica preoccupazione…. un mucchio di app di merda, qualche idiota vorrà ingrassare il portafoglio per qualche stupidaggine (magari almeno per caricarlo su AppStore ci vorrà un Mac, che almeno possa selezionarlo un po'), non credo che tutto andrà bene compila sempre correttamente, il processo di approvazione si trascina anche per quelle buone app... ma poi vedo molti più aspetti negativi che positivi.
Per me, il problema principale con lo sviluppo è che non possiedo un Mac. In questo modo potrò finalmente provare a fare domanda. Posso lavorare facilmente con Flex e ActionScript e sarà sicuramente più facile migliorare che imparare C o XCode, di cui non conosco una sola riga (normalmente faccio cose in Java).
C è una cosa, ma anche per me che conosco C in molti modi, Objective-C è stata una doccia fredda a causa della sua sintassi e dell'approccio all'OOP.
E come ha scritto Oriesko. Ciò comporterà un altro enorme aumento nel numero di domande presentate e non voglio vedere quale impatto avrà sul già lento processo di approvazione.
Beh, è molto interessante. Sarà anche possibile utilizzare le API dell'iphone per accelerometro, geolocalizzazione, ecc. Tuttavia la zavorra aumenterà, chissà se Apple reagirà in qualche modo. Ad ogni modo, credo che col tempo troveremo alcune belle applicazioni che non sarebbero state create senza Flash.
è finalmente arrivato. Per me, Xcode su Win sarebbe l'ideale, ma neanche questa sembra una cattiva idea. E penso che Apple non dovrebbe limitare le persone nello sviluppo dell'applicazione.